--- id: catlog22/Claude-Code-Workflow/ccw-chain version: "aecac4a9" license: MIT install: manual updated: 2026-06-18 --- # ccw-chain — CCW Chain orchestrates multi-step workflows by analyzing user intent, routing to the appropriate chain, and executing skill pipelines through progressive step loading. It supports auto mode for hands-off execution, delegation between chains, and variable propagation across the entire workflow. Match user intent to chain `triggers.task_types` / `triggers.keywords` 3. `chain_loader inspect` — preview chain node graph and available entries 4. `chain_loader start` — begin from default entry, named entry (`entry_name`), or any node (`node`) ## Execution Protocol When `chain_loader` delivers a step node with a skill/command doc: 1. **Read** the loaded doc content to understand the skill's purpose and interface 2. **Assemble** the Skill call: `Skill(skill_name, args)` - First step: `args = "${analysis.goal}"` - Subsequent steps: `args = ""` (auto-receives session context) - Special args noted in step name (e.g., `--bugfix`, `--hotfix`, `--plan-only`) 3. **Propagate -y**: If auto mode active, append `-y` to args 4. **Execute**: `Skill(skill_name, args)` — blocking, wait for completion 5. **Advance**: `chain_loader done` to proceed to next step ```javascript const autoYes = /\b(-y|--yes)\b/.test($ARGUMENTS); function assembleCommand(skillName, args, previousResult) { if (!args && previousResult?.session_id) { args = `--session="${previousResult.session_id}"`; } if (autoYes && !args.includes('-y') && !args.includes('--yes')) { args = args ? `${args} -y` : '-y'; } return { skill: skillName, args }; } ``` ## Auto Mode (`-y` / `--yes`) - D1 Clarity Check: always choose "Clear" (skip clarification) - Confirmation: skip, execute directly - Error handling: auto-skip failed steps, continue pipeline - Propagation: `-y` injected into every downstream Skill call ## Delegation Protocol When `chain_loader` returns `delegate_depth > 0`: 1. Continue normal execution (read content, assemble Skill, execute) 2. On `returned_from_delegate: true`, resume parent chain context 3. Variables received from child chain are available for subsequent steps ## Preloaded Context When `chain_loader start` returns `preloaded_keys`: 1. Preloaded content is available via `chain_loader content` for the entire session 2. Reference preloaded context when assembling Skill calls 3. Use preloaded memory/project context to inform all downstream steps ## Progress Visualization After each `chain_loader done`, call `chain_loader visualize` to show progress. Display the visualization in execution log for user awareness. ## Variable Propagation Intent analysis results (`task_type`, `goal`, `auto_yes`) are stored as chain variables. `assembleCommand()` reads variables from `chain_loader status` for Skill args. Variables automatically flow through delegation via `pass_variables`/`receive_variables`. ## Phase-Level Execution (Skill Chain Delegation) When the current chain is a skill-level chain (entered via delegation from a category chain): 1. Each step delivers **phase doc content** directly (not SKILL.md) 2. **Execute phase instructions inline** — do NOT wrap in `Skill()` call 3. Reference preloaded `skill-context` for orchestration patterns (TodoWrite, data flow, error handling) 4. Phase execution produces artifacts (files, session state) consumed by the next phase 5. The chain system controls phase progression — no need for internal phase orchestration ## Architecture: Chain Definition Layers - **Category chains** (8): `ccw-chain/chains/` — routing and orchestration (ccw-main, ccw-standard, etc.) - **Workflow skill chains** (7): `.claude/workflow-skills/*/chains/` — skill-level chains with phase content - **Phase content**: `.claude/skills/*/phases/` — original phase files, referenced via `@skills/` prefix - Category chains delegate to workflow skill chains via `findChainAcrossSkills()` fallback - Content refs: `@phases/` = skill-relative, `@skills/` = project `.claude/skills/` relative [View on SkillFed](https://skillfed.io/catlog22/Claude-Code-Workflow/ccw-chain) · [View on GitHub](https://github.com/catlog22/Claude-Code-Workflow)
